Hartford Courant: Can the Nationalistic Medal Count for Athens 2004
Sounds like a good idea, hey lets NOT piss off the rest of the world by saying WE WANT 100 MEDALS DAMMIT.

"The resolve is admirable. Terrorists have no place among nations. They wave no flag except one of cowardice. Yet America's Olympic movement also must not be blind to the fact that, thanks to the Iraqi quagmire, we are seen by too much of the world as the global bully. In 1964, the time was right for medal counts against the Soviet Union. Forty years later, the time is right for ratcheting down steroid nationalism. We can still win and win big without going cowboy. Why not drop the medal count? Why doesn't someone come up with an outfit for the Americans to wear away from the field of play in Athens? Something that would incorporate goodwill and peace. In the cradle of the Olympic movement, why not let it be us who bend over backward to extend international friendship? In her last Olympics, there's nothing Mia Hamm, who is looking at starting a family, can do to stop terrorism in Athens. But maybe there's something she can do to help plant a seed so bin Laden's son will not want to blow up her and Nomar's daughter at the 2028 Olympics."
